PURPOSE: To prevent a temperature of an iron base from rising abnormally even if, by any chance, a receiving device malfunction by an interference signal and hence an iron stand is heated by receiving a heating signal, by providing a second temperature-detecting device on a standby part for an iron.
CONSTITUTION: When a receiving device 35 malfunctions by jamming during ironing-work, a second temperature-detecting device 32 can not detect it. At usual ironing work, since an iron body 21 is replaced on a standby part 31 when clothes are manipulated, however, the second-temperature-detecting device 32 can detect the conduction heat transmitted to the standby part 31 when the iron body 21 is placed on the standby part 31. When this detected temperature rises and is beyond a second specified temperature, the second temperature- detecting device 32 outputs a stopping signal to an inverter 34 and the inverter 34 stops for a definite time. In this way, even if the receiving device 35 malfunctions by the jamming, an abnormal temperature rise can be prevented.
